To make the most of your trip, it’s essential to plan your visit in advance. Check the official website for opening hours, special events, and any ticket promotions. Weekdays are typically less crowded, which can enhance your children's experience as they navigate through interactive stations without the hustle.
Upon arriving, grab a map of the museum. The Hong Kong Science Museum is spacious, spanning several floors and housing over 500 exhibits. Begin at the main entrance and make your way to the popular introductory exhibits, which provide a good overview of what to expect.
One of the highlights of the museum is its numerous interactive exhibits designed for young minds. Engage your kids by allowing them to participate in hands-on activities. The Energy Machine and the 3D Space Theater are perfect for sparking interest in physics and astronomy. Encourage your children to ask questions and explore the exhibits at their own pace.
The museum features an IMAX theater that showcases educational films in stunning detail. Be sure to check the schedule for showtimes that cater to children's interests. Enticing films about nature and space explore complex subjects in an easily digestible manner, making for a fun learning experience.
Look out for hands-on workshops or demonstrations that may take place during your visit. These are great opportunities for your kids to delve deeper into topics like robotics or electronics with guided assistance. Participating in these activities allows children to engage directly with scientific concepts, reinforcing what they have learned throughout the museum.
After a few hours of exploration, plan for breaks to keep spirits high and ensure everyone remains energized. The museum has designated resting areas, and you can also enjoy light snacks or meals at the on-site café. This downtime is essential for recharging before diving back into more exhibits!
To keep the kids engaged, consider creating a scavenger hunt before your visit. List specific exhibits or objects for them to find, turning their exploration into a fun game. This combines exercise with education and encourages teamwork among siblings or friends.
Before leaving, stop by the museum store to check out science-themed toys and books. This is an excellent way to continue the learning experience at home. Pick out educational games or kits that reinforce what your children learned during their visit, catering to their newfound interests.
